Payment Policy
To improve efficiency and
maximize value for our customer’s fiber processing investments
Georgia Mountain Fiber has implemented a new payment policy.
Effective March 31, 2005,
all fiber processing services require a 50% down payment upon
receipt of the fiber. Fiber processing services provided by Georgia
Mountain Fiber must be paid in full at the time of completion,
unless otherwise noted.
Your invoice will be
emailed to you upon the completion of your order. Should you not be
Internet ready, we will give you a call.
Payment options include:
MasterCard, Visa and Debit Cards. Checks are no longer accepted.
Orders that are outstanding
for 30 days will incur a 5% finance charge. Finance charges will
accrue by 5% every 30 days that the payment is late. Should the
account remain unpaid after 60 days, the end products will be
relinquished to Georgia Mountain Fiber.
